Stake-out Aids RS95 and RS96
Stake-out aids RS95 and RS96 were developed specifically for stake-out work on batter boards and
floor slabs. Exact measurement of floor slab reference points often presents major challenges, particu-
larly in “final phase” with the last 5-10 cm. The work can be very time-consuming due to the continual
side-to-side, backwards and forwards, movement of the prism pole which must remain plumb.
Stake-out aid RS95 or foldable stake-out aid RS96 is placed on the ground and the rodmen can use
consistent offsets to reproduce and transfer the surveyor’s directions quickly and precisely.
Advantages of the stake-out aids:
→ They make surveying the axis on batter boards easier.
→ Stake-out on the floor slab in final phases (5-10 cm) can be measured quickly and precisely.
→ The surveyor’s dimensional data can be transferred accurately to the floor slab.
→ There is no need for precise plumbing of prism poles
→ Orientation scale for left and right - the number 10 corresponds to the axis.
→ Orientation scales for backwards and forwards.
→ Foldable: fits in any shirt pocket (only RS96)
